About Desert of Maine

The Desert of Maine is a weird and wonderful place. It is far more than just the 20 acres of rolling sand dunes in the middle of a lush forest. It has rich history going back to the 1800s, and it has been an iconic tourist destination in Maine for nearly 100 years. It is fun, educational, beautiful--well-suited for families with kids, history buffs, nature lovers, science nerds, and curious travelers. It has exhibits that explore the history, geology, and ecology of this fascinating place along with fun this to do like play mini golf, take a train ride, shop in 1930s era gift shop, or have an ice cream.
